These workshops are for people who may be considering self-employment.
Each session covers a different theme. They take place in a low-pressure environment that:
- prioritises trust
- wellbeing, and
- with social connection as the basis for taking part.
The sessions include the use of conversation-starter topics related to self-employment. There is a focus on creativity, storytelling, and aspiration-building as tools for developing confidence. They take place at various times and locations across the city and online. For more information, contact Katie Matthews-Furphy by emailing [email protected].
Workshops are free and you don't need to register. You can attend as many sessions as you like.
